Verse 2:206 in Context

Translator Abdel Haleem
202 أُو۟لَـٰۤىِٕكَ لَهُمۡ نَصِیبࣱ مِّمَّا كَسَبُوا۟ۚ وَٱللَّهُ سَرِیعُ ٱلۡحِسَابِ ۝٢٠٢ ulāika lahum naṣībun mimmā kasabū wal-lahu sarīʿu l-ḥisāb They will have the share they have worked for: God is swift in reckoning 203 ۞ وَٱذۡكُرُوا۟ ٱللَّهَ فِیۤ أَیَّامࣲ مَّعۡدُودَ ٰتࣲۚ فَمَن تَعَجَّلَ فِی یَوۡمَیۡنِ فَلَاۤ إِثۡمَ عَلَیۡهِ وَمَن تَأَخَّرَ فَلَاۤ إِثۡمَ عَلَیۡهِۖ لِمَنِ ٱتَّقَىٰۗ وَٱتَّقُوا۟ ٱللَّهَ وَٱعۡلَمُوۤا۟ أَنَّكُمۡ إِلَیۡهِ تُحۡشَرُونَ ۝٢٠٣ wa-udh'kurū l-laha fī ayyāmin maʿdūdātin faman taʿajjala fī yawmayni falā ith'ma ʿalayhi waman ta-akhara falā ith'ma ʿalayhi limani ittaqā wa-ittaqū l-laha wa-iʿ'lamū annakum ilayhi tuḥ'sharūn Remember God on the appointed days. If anyone is in a hurry to leave after two days, there is no blame on him, nor is there any blame on anyone who stays on, so long as they are mindful of God. Be mindful of God, and remember that you will be gathered to Him 204 وَمِنَ ٱلنَّاسِ مَن یُعۡجِبُكَ قَوۡلُهُۥ فِی ٱلۡحَیَوٰةِ ٱلدُّنۡیَا وَیُشۡهِدُ ٱللَّهَ عَلَىٰ مَا فِی قَلۡبِهِۦ وَهُوَ أَلَدُّ ٱلۡخِصَامِ ۝٢٠٤ wamina l-nāsi man yuʿ'jibuka qawluhu fī l-ḥayati l-dun'yā wayush'hidu l-laha ʿalā mā fī qalbihi wahuwa aladdu l-khiṣām There is [a kind of] man whose views on the life of this world may please you [Prophet], he even calls on God to witness what is in his heart, yet he is the bitterest of opponents 205 وَإِذَا تَوَلَّىٰ سَعَىٰ فِی ٱلۡأَرۡضِ لِیُفۡسِدَ فِیهَا وَیُهۡلِكَ ٱلۡحَرۡثَ وَٱلنَّسۡلَۗ وَٱللَّهُ لَا یُحِبُّ ٱلۡفَسَادَ ۝٢٠٥ wa-idhā tawallā saʿā fī l-arḍi liyuf'sida fīhā wayuh'lika l-ḥartha wal-nasla wal-lahu lā yuḥibbu l-fasād When he leaves, he sets out to spread corruption in the land, destroying crops and live-stock- God does not like corruption
206 وَإِذَا قِیلَ لَهُ ٱتَّقِ ٱللَّهَ أَخَذَتۡهُ ٱلۡعِزَّةُ بِٱلۡإِثۡمِۚ فَحَسۡبُهُۥ جَهَنَّمُۖ وَلَبِئۡسَ ٱلۡمِهَادُ ۝٢٠٦ wa-idhā qīla lahu ittaqi l-laha akhadhathu l-ʿizatu bil-ith'mi faḥasbuhu jahannamu walabi'sa l-mihād When he is told, ‘Beware of God,’ his arrogance leads him to sin. Hell is enough for him: a dreadful resting place
207 وَمِنَ ٱلنَّاسِ مَن یَشۡرِی نَفۡسَهُ ٱبۡتِغَاۤءَ مَرۡضَاتِ ٱللَّهِۗ وَٱللَّهُ رَءُوفُۢ بِٱلۡعِبَادِ ۝٢٠٧ wamina l-nāsi man yashrī nafsahu ib'tighāa marḍāti l-lahi wal-lahu raūfun bil-ʿibād But there is also a kind of man who gives his life away to please God, and God is most compassionate to His servants 208 یَـٰۤأَیُّهَا ٱلَّذِینَ ءَامَنُوا۟ ٱدۡخُلُوا۟ فِی ٱلسِّلۡمِ كَاۤفَّةࣰ وَلَا تَتَّبِعُوا۟ خُطُوَ ٰتِ ٱلشَّیۡطَـٰنِۚ إِنَّهُۥ لَكُمۡ عَدُوࣱّ مُّبِینࣱ ۝٢٠٨ yāayyuhā alladhīna āmanū ud'khulū fī l-sil'mi kāffatan walā tattabiʿū khuṭuwāti l-shayṭāni innahu lakum ʿaduwwun mubīnu You who believe, enter wholeheartedly into submission to God and do not follow in Satan’s footsteps, for he is your sworn enemy 209 فَإِن زَلَلۡتُم مِّنۢ بَعۡدِ مَا جَاۤءَتۡكُمُ ٱلۡبَیِّنَـٰتُ فَٱعۡلَمُوۤا۟ أَنَّ ٱللَّهَ عَزِیزٌ حَكِیمٌ ۝٢٠٩ fa-in zalaltum min baʿdi mā jāatkumu l-bayinātu fa-iʿ'lamū anna l-laha ʿazīzun ḥakīmu If you slip back after clear proof has come to you, then be aware that God is almighty and wise 210 هَلۡ یَنظُرُونَ إِلَّاۤ أَن یَأۡتِیَهُمُ ٱللَّهُ فِی ظُلَلࣲ مِّنَ ٱلۡغَمَامِ وَٱلۡمَلَـٰۤىِٕكَةُ وَقُضِیَ ٱلۡأَمۡرُۚ وَإِلَى ٱللَّهِ تُرۡجَعُ ٱلۡأُمُورُ ۝٢١٠ hal yanẓurūna illā an yatiyahumu l-lahu fī ẓulalin mina l-ghamāmi wal-malāikatu waquḍiya l-amru wa-ilā l-lahi tur'jaʿu l-umūr Are these people waiting for God to come to them in the shadows of the clouds, together with the angels? But the matter would already have been decided by then: all matters are brought back to God
